This abstract first appeared for US patent application 20240311943 titled 'APPARATUS AND METHODS FOR POINT-TO-POINT TRANSPORTATION

Simplified Explanation: The patent application describes a centrally controlled smart transportation system that can provide point-to-point transportation of people and goods. The system can allocate tunneled routes to individual vehicles and coordinate the travel of different vehicles to allow them to cross intersections without stopping or colliding.

Original Abstract Submitted

centrally controlled smart transportation systems can provide point-to-point transportation of people and goods. the systems may be configured to allocate tunneled routes to individual vehicles. travel of different vehicles can be coordinated so that vehicles can cross level intersections without stopping and without collisions. a transportation system may include a hierarchical network of controllers that control individual vehicles to maintain allowed positions that have been reserved for the vehicles in traffic streams.
